The depletion of most onshore and near shore off-shore oil reserves has shifted the focus of petroleum exploration and production to deep water off-shore word wide. Owing to the greater depths and different type of related physical environment and associated risks involved i.e. deep-water, the future pipelines need to be designed and analyzed with a different approach as compared to those onshore. The work presents a comprehensive yet concise structural analysis methodology of a deep water pipeline. The parameter investigated is expected-but-unforeseeable axial change in length coupled with deflection as a result of a conceptual before-service hydrostatic testing of a fairly long deep-water pipeline section. Various simple, plausible and most commonly confronted physical scenarios and situations in off-shore pipeline laying are presented with different possible corresponding loading schemes and, analyzed and discussed before delineating the conclusions. It has been endeavored to implement both analytical and numerical solution where ever possible supported by consistent background theory for adequate understanding.
